When he heard that the emperor also killed many people back then, Russell was actually taken aback.

After all, the emperor is a hero subordinate to his uncle Dodgson, director, and the big orange doesn't look like such a violent person...

In other words, one of the reasons why Dodgson was selected as a director at that time was precisely because he was not violent enough.

He is a rather gentle and flexible person with a rare good reputation in the group.

At the same time, his stance is not firm enough, his views are not outstanding enough, his thinking is not sharp enough, and he has no ability or desire to change the status quo... In another world, with Dodgson's qualities, he might be able to become a prime minister.

And in this world, he also held the supreme power—he made the elves trust him and let him share the supreme authority in this world.

Such a gentle sheep, but the "hero" under his hands is actually a hardcore?

Malt Wine probably guessed what her godfather was thinking.

Without waiting for the godfather to ask, she replied in a timely manner: "Although the director behind the emperor, Dodgson, is known as a good old man...but the emperor he chose is not like that.

"The emperor has been known for his aggressive actions since the very beginning—he used his heroic status to kill criminals in the street with brutal methods; he toughly executed small company directors and local bullies whom the people resented.

"Once, a group of gangsters broke into the TV station and forced them to broadcast their own program. The purpose was to hold the people hostage and let the Tianen Group release their arrested boss. The staff. At this time, the emperor broke into the TV station and shot the criminal directly. Afterwards, the emperor directly issued a speech on the chaotic TV station and in front of the camera to the people, calling on people not to accept the kidnapper's behavior. Conditions, don't compromise with them - when this happens, it's the day of the 'hero'.

"This is also one of the sources of his title of 'emperor'. There are not a few new generation heroes who accepted the emperor's call and became heroes... Although our positions are opposite, I do think that he is a very attractive man. In When he was at his most active, everything he did was admired by people—it was on the news almost every week, which was even more popular than the popular 'Ultramarine'."

As Malt Wine spoke, he subconsciously licked his lips.

After all, all the people in Eternal Tribulation Reincarnation are smart people, and they rarely do stupid things like kidnapping. They're even trying to keep silent, and at their best they're like ale, never registered on any record, completely clean.

"...Of course, people lamented that what the emperor said was true. But when it happened to them, they would still obey the kidnappers' orders. This is why those idiots in the veil of ignorance don't understand anything but can always succeed. .”

Malt Wine's words were full of undisguised disgust.

The veil of ignorance doesn't understand anything at all, just buy the information and kidnap the relatives of the rich businessman, and you can easily get a lot of resources. And they spend forever reincarnating, working hard, forging their identities, using their own minds and knowledge, and taking the risk of being discovered as uncoded people to defraud, and in the end they get no more than the veil of ignorance.

In the case of similar benefits, the only difference between the two sides is that the probability of death or injury after the mission of the veil of ignorance is relatively high-but the people in the veil of ignorance are overwhelmingly large, and casual death will not hurt the bones. And the people on her side are all elites from all walks of life... While possessing knowledge and wisdom, they are also rare talents with a clear lack of moral bottom line, so I dare not let them die.

But after the veil of ignorance made matters worse, and the upper city sent inferior people down, they would still be unlucky.

"I see…"

The godfather murmured in a low voice: "Director Dodgson must have done it on purpose.

"Looks like he's not exactly a docile fool, either."

The godfather sneered and said, "I chose the emperor as the knife in my hand to let him do things that are inconvenient for me. In the end, the bad reputation will be filtered out by the emperor, and the good reputation will belong to him... What a good plan."

— Well done, uncle.

Contrary to the coldness on the godfather's face, Russell was very relieved.

Russell always felt that Dodgson's character was too easy to suffer.

Even if he has a good temper, he doesn't think it's a disadvantage... But since he is in this position, he has to be responsible for any decision. He doesn't argue with others, and if things go wrong or he makes a mistake, the blame is his.

Directors of the head office cannot stay in office for a lifetime, they always have to retire. They have plenty of money, and their living time is bound to be much longer than their working hours... When they lose these temporary powers, the pots that were waiting for them in the past will fly over by themselves.

Highlight a ten thousand pots returning to the clan.

With the emperor, Dodgson can do what he wants to do. What he didn't expect and didn't want to do, naturally the emperor was willing to do it for him.

The emperor was much more ruthless than Dodgeson—not only ruthless, but also ruthless.

Contrary to what malt liquor thought, the emperor was not a pure "hero".

From Russell's position, it can be clearly seen... From the very beginning, the emperor was cultivating political capital for himself.

Such things as "heroic acts of righteousness" cannot always be sought after by the public. Because the public is always short-sighted and self-interested, when the "altruistic" attribute of the hero coincides with the "self-interested" attribute of the public, people will pursue and worship the hero; but if the hero knows something that the public does not know, But to do things that people can't understand, people will reprimand these heroes for being "talkative" and "messy" because their own interests are shaken.

Because of this, a qualified hero can never leave only a "good name".

His heart will always call him to do something that is temporarily not understood by people. Maybe later people will realize what the right thing he did back then, and maybe confess to him... But that kind of thing doesn't make any sense anymore.

What's the use of repenting and apologizing when the harm to people's hearts has already been done?

And what the emperor did was "too correct".

That is not something he does according to his own heart, but a "performance" after considering what the public wants him to do.

It was the same as the "talk show" performed by the emperor later. He has wisdom and knows a lot of secrets, but talk shows are not about telling the truth, and it’s over if you dare to tell the truth... If you want to be popular, you can only selectively tell a part of the truth to stimulate the audience, and then tell the audience The truths that I want to hear the most, but I can't think of, cater to their views.

And these words, they themselves may not believe it.

Russell knows this because he himself is such a "shown hero."

When he learned what the name "hero" meant in Happy Island and what kind of risks he would take, he always paid attention to his words and deeds so as not to cause conflicts in public opinion.

And after the emperor cultivated enough prestige, he changed jobs very smoothly and became a capitalist behind the scenes, retiring to the second line.

This is also his reward for blocking the pot for Dodgson - in his position, he is a commoner and a veteran idol, and he is not afraid to take the pot.

If a lot of blame is thrown on Dodgson, it will make him very embarrassed...and if it is thrown on the emperor, it will only increase his heat.

Dodgson's ability to choose the emperor as his "hero" is a manifestation of his political wisdom.

From this point of view, it seems that "heroes" are not as simple as white gloves. It's not just for doing dirty work... He and the director behind the scenes belong to a cooperative and symbiotic relationship.

The directors of the head office provide guarantees for the heroes and clear away the top-down pressure of various forces for them; while the heroes are responsible for saying what the directors dare not say and doing what the directors dare not do, as a kind of complementary symbiosis.

Just as the Tianen Group's board of directors is considering promoting the "Seventh Consensus" to grant heroes more power... that is also the process of gradually freeing themselves from the shackles of the dragon.

The board of directors—or rather, the elf directors—had no longer satisfied the powers the dragon had bestowed upon them. On the eve of the depletion of resources, I finally couldn't help but start to take action, seeking higher power...the power that the dragons had previously prevented the elves from touching.

—If you start from this point.

Then what "Tiansong" did could not be caused by his personal grievances.

His true position ~www.wuxiahere.com~ determines the truth behind this increasingly confused matter.

So Russell made up his mind—

Today, I will use the identity of Ultramarine to meet that "Heavenly Sent".

The off-court assistance he can call without a trace has basically been exhausted. Then it was up to him to do it himself.
